Pros

Benefits are great. Retirement package changed drastically just before I was hired. Now it's nothing.

Cons

Morale is bad as upper management is out of touch with phone reps. I believe if they did the job even3 hours a month, they would have a fresh perspective. No wonder the turnover is 50% in good times. Now, only 33%? The VP message was good. Being a global company, what motivates US employees is not the same as someone elsewhere. We are different here in the US when it's all said and done. Information from higher ups is lacking. What you get is from rumor. You only find out what is new once you have violated policy/ procedure. Really lacking information circulation from where it needs to come from. I get my info from a rep who has ties to a former location. This rep is still in the loop there and that location requires mgrs. to be on the phones 3 hrs. a week. Now that is a true reality check.
